Get started4 Calvert Road is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Greenwich, London, London (SE10 0DF). It has a recorded floor area of 126 m² (around 1356 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(January 2022)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in May 2018 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 85). Sale prices here have outpaced London HPI: 7.6%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£796/sq ft) was about 84.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 126 m² the property is well over the postcode median (93 m² across 41 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 73% of similar EPCs). Most recent transfer: May 2024 at £1,080,000.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
